Medical Director
Vancouver, WA
Lifeline Connections is seeking a dedicated and experienced Medical Director with a specialization in addiction medicine to join our team in Vancouver, WA. This role involves working closely with executive leadership to develop and implement medical services, policies, and programs that integrate physical and behavioral health.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in managing complex co-morbidities and fostering relationships within a diverse team of healthcare providers.
Key Responsibilities
Regulatory Compliance: Review and ensure compliance with Washington Administrative Codes (WACs), Revised Codes (RCWs), CARF Standards, and Federal regulations.
Quality Improvement: Collaborate with the VP of Quality and Corporate Compliance to evaluate and enhance the Quality Assurance and Improvement program.
Team Leadership: Recruit, supervise, and build relationships with physicians, nurse practitioners, and physician assistants.
Program Development: Develop and oversee Fellowships in collaboration with local hospitals and community partners.
Training: Prepare and present in-service training to clinical staff on evolving trends in behavioral health medical care.
Program Implementation: Assist in the development and implementation of new programs aimed at integrating physical and behavioral health.
Agency Goals: Work with management to set and achieve agency goals.
Policy Support: Support and implement agency policies and procedures.
After-Hours Availability: Provide higher-level oversight after hours as needed.
Patient Care: Initiate additional testing, develop treatment plans, refer patients to other healthcare services, and collaborate on patient diagnosis and treatment.
Consultation: Provide consultation within the agency and coordinate with other providers for specialized training programs.
Community Engagement: Maintain positive relationships with community agencies and clinics to ensure coordinated care.
Qualifications
Education: Medical Degree required; specialization in addiction medicine preferred.
Licensure: Current WA State DOH medical license with prescriptive authority; additional addiction certifications/training preferred.
Experience: Proven experience working with patients with complex co-morbidities.
Skills:
Strong written and verbal communication skills
Excellent management skills
Adept computer skills
Interpersonal and conflict-resolution skills
